Invinity Energy Systems (LON:IES) and DFS Furniture (LON:DFS) are both small-cap banking companies, but which is the superior stock? We will contrast the two businesses based on the strength of their media sentiment, institutional ownership, profitability, dividends, valuation, earnings, risk and analyst recommendations.

37.3% of Invinity Energy Systems sh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 81.1% of DFS Furniture shares are held by institutional investors. 34.4% of Invinity Energy Systems shares are held by company insiders. Comparatively, 11.7% of DFS Furniture shares are held by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that endowments, hedge funds and large money managers believe a stock will outperform the market over the long term.

In the previous week, DFS Furniture had 3 more articles in the media than Invinity Energy Systems. MarketBeat recorded 3 mentions for DFS Furniture and 0 mentions for Invinity Energy Systems. Invinity Energy Systems' average media sentiment score of 0.00 beat DFS Furniture's score of -0.05 indicating that Invinity Energy Systems is being referred to more favorably in the media.

Invinity Energy Systems currently has a consensus target price of GBX 40, suggesting a potential upside of 66.67%. DFS Furniture has a consensus target price of GBX 233, suggesting a potential upside of 40.79%. Given Invinity Energy Systems' higher probable upside, equities analysts clearly believe Invinity Energy Systems is more favorable than DFS Furniture.

Invinity Energy Systems has a beta of 2.24, indicating that its share price is 124%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, DFS Furniture has a beta of 1.58, indicating that its share price is 58% more volatile than the S&P 500.

DFS Furniture has higher revenue and earnings than Invinity Energy Systems. DFS Furniture is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Invinity Energy Systems,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.

DFS Furniture has a net margin of -0.45% compared to Invinity Energy Systems' net margin of -237.38%. DFS Furniture's return on equity of -1.90% beat Invinity Energy Systems' return on equity.
